Ohyama Ramen is a little slice of Japanese culture in the heart of Whistler Village. The interior is dressed to make you feel like you’re in a small street of Japan grabbing a bowl of ramen, which is cute.

The pricing here is pretty standard to that of Vancouver prices (although maybe slightly more expensive for certain dishes, but it’s Whistler!).

I ordered the Vegan Ramen – it’s made with kale noodles (yep, it’s a thing!), shiitake, corn, rape blossom, bean sprouts, onion chips, garlic oil all in a nice, warm, creamy veggie broth. Ramen is always a great choice to have, especially when you’re in cooler temperatures. It was a nice, comforting but quick meal to have in the village.
